Synopsis

In any normal situation Fiona and Sarah would be friends. They are both smart and loving, great mothers, brilliant at life. But when Sarah arrives in Fiona's small seaside town, it's not a normal situation. Sarah is on a mission and before either she or Fiona know it - and without her meaning to cause havoc - that single-minded vision has turned both their worlds upside-down.Fiona and Sarah both discover that just as love drains out of lives that are routine and taken for granted, so it can also flow back into those lives in unexpected and breathtaking ways. And where the love gets in, it changes things forever ...

Author Bio
Before becoming a full-time writer, Tara Heavey was a solicitor. She finds writing much more satisfying. She lives in the countryside with her husband and three children. Where the Love Gets In is her fifth novel.
